K2 of 5 Lab 2: Question 1 When a thermal inversion layer is over a city (as happens often in Los Angles), pollutants cannot rise vertically, but get trapped below the layer and must disperse horizontally Assume that a factory smokestack begins emitting a pollutant at 8 A.M. and that the pollutant disperses horizontally over a circular area. Suppose that trepresents the time, in hours, since the factory began emitting pollutants (t = 0 represents 8 A.M.), and assume that the radius of the circle of pollution is r(t) 2t miles. Let A( r) ? r2 represent the area of the circle of radius r. (a) Find (A° r) (t). Submit to Class
